Kūh-e Shīā
Kūh-e Shīā is a mountain in Kurdistan Province, Iran and has an elevation of 2,012 metres. Kūh-e Shīā is situated nearby to the village Hashli, as well as near Turivar.| Tap on a place to explore it |
